Word教程网教你Excel VBA:在窗体上画房子不是梦
在现今数字化时代,Excel已经成为我们生活和工作中不可或缺的一部分。然而,许多人可能仅仅停留在使用Excel的基本功能上,对于其强大的VBA(Visual Basic for Applications)编程功能知之甚少。今天,Word教程网就来为大家揭秘Excel VBA的魅力,并教大家如何利用VBA在Excel窗体上绘制一个简单的房子,让你的Excel之旅变得更加有趣和高效。
一、Excel VBA简介
Excel VBA是一种编程语言,它允许用户自定义Excel的功能,实现自动化处理、创建自定义函数、以及创建自定义窗体等。通过VBA,我们可以编写代码来操作Excel表格、处理数据、甚至创建复杂的用户界面。虽然VBA的学习曲线可能有些陡峭,但只要掌握了它,你将能够解锁Excel的无限可能。
二、准备工作
在开始绘制房子之前,我们需要确保已经启用了Excel的“开发者”选项卡,并熟悉如何插入和编辑窗体控件。如果你还没有做过这些,不用担心,Word教程网将为你提供详细的步骤指导。
三、绘制房子的步骤
- 插入窗体
首先,我们需要在Excel中插入一个窗体。点击“开发者”选项卡中的“插入”按钮,在弹出的菜单中选择“UserForm”。这将创建一个新的空白窗体,我们可以在这个窗体上进行绘制。
- 添加控件
接下来,我们需要添加一些控件来绘制房子的各个部分。例如,我们可以使用“矩形”控件来绘制房子的墙壁,使用“线条”控件来绘制屋顶和门窗等。通过调整控件的大小、位置和颜色,我们可以逐渐勾勒出房子的轮廓。
- 编写代码
当然,仅仅依靠控件的拖拽还不足以实现一个完整的房子。我们还需要编写一些VBA代码来控制这些控件的行为。例如,我们可以编写代码来实现门窗的开关动画,或者让房子根据用户的输入改变颜色等。这些代码可以写在窗体的初始化事件中,也可以写在按钮的点击事件中。
- 调试和优化
在完成初步的绘制和编码后,我们需要对窗体进行调试和优化。检查是否有控件重叠、错位或者代码错误等问题,并进行相应的调整。同时,我们还可以考虑添加一些交互功能,比如让用户可以自定义房子的样式、颜色等。
四、注意事项
在绘制房子的过程中,有几点需要注意:
- 控件的属性和方法需要熟悉,以便能够灵活地使用它们来绘制图形。
- 编写代码时要遵循良好的编程习惯,确保代码的可读性和可维护性。
- 在调试过程中要耐心细致,及时发现并解决问题。
五、结语
通过以上的步骤,我们已经在Excel窗体上成功地绘制出了一个简单的房子。虽然这只是一个简单的示例,但它展示了Excel VBA的强大功能和无限可能。只要你愿意花时间和精力去学习和探索,相信你也能利用VBA在Excel中创造出更多有趣和实用的功能。
Word教程网将继续为大家带来更多关于Excel VBA的教程和技巧,帮助大家更好地掌握这项技能。如果你对Excel VBA感兴趣,或者有任何疑问和建议,欢迎在评论区留言交流。让我们一起在Excel的世界里探索更多未知的乐趣吧!